I need help to configure my Ubuntustudio on my machine. Currently, I have _nothing_, just installed it on my Machine.
It's an Oneiric Ocelot Ubuntu Studio.
My Hardware:
    -    Soundcard: ESI Juli@
    -    Midikeyboard: Midistart 3
    -    Drumcontroller: Akai MPD24
    -    Speakers: Fostex PM04
    -    Microphone: AT3035
    -    Amp: Presonus TubePre

Usergroups I'm in: adm, dialout, cdrom, audio, plugdev, lpadmin, admin, sambashare

The Midikeyboard is conected to the Soundcard by an Midi-cable, the MPD via USB. "cat /proc/asound/cards" tells me that the soundcard is deteced! It's listed as 3rd device. I don't know what the second one is, because there is just the default (onboard) soundcard and the ESI. If I open alsamixer and select the ESI via F6, there is still no sound. I don't know where my problem is and google just tells me to use alsamixer and cat /proc... I test by playing the File in /usr/share/sounds/alsa/Front_Center.wav with aplay or with the default music player by clicking on a Music file.

If I use aplay there's an error output:

ALSA lib confmisc.c:1286:(snd_func_refer) Unable to find definition 'defaults.namehint.basic' ALSA lib conf.c:4184:(_snd_config_evaluate) function snd_func_refer returned error: Datei oder Verzeichnis nicht gefunden (1) ALSA lib conf.c:4663:(snd_config_expand) Evaluate error: Datei oder Verzeichnis nicht gefunden (1)
ALSA lib pcm.c:2212:(snc_pcm_open_noupdate) Unknown PCM default
aplay: main:660: Fehler beim Öffnen des Gerätes: Datei oder Verzeichnis nicht gefunden (2)

(1) File or Directory not found
(2) Error opening device: File or Directory not found
